Shoveling, Digging Out Biggest Disruption During Snow Storms

Web voters say shoveling and digging out is the biggest disruption to their lives as a result of the recent snow storms.

In an online poll taken February 8 through February 16 that attracted 138 voters, 36 percent of web voters said shoveling and digging out was the most disruptive part of their lives during the recent snow storms. Hazardous driving conditions received 26 percent of the vote, and missing work and power outages followed with 14 percent each.

Closing of school received nine percent of the web vote, with finding a baby sitter receiving one percent.
